2

我已经单独下载了 pgagent 3.4.1 和 pgAdmin 4。我想从 pgAdmin 内部创建作业,就像解释 https://www.openscg.com/bigsql/docs/pgadmin4/pgagent_install.html但是当我执行命令时我得到错误: ERROR: could not open extension control file "E:/Program Files (x86)/PostgreSQL/9.6/share/extension/pgagent.control": No such file or directory SQL state: 58P01。是否有任何链接详细说明如何从 pgAdmin 4 内部安装和使用 pgAgent?

4

2 回答 2

6

如果您将使用 EnterpriseDB GUI 安装程序,这将非常容易。

1) 从 EnterpriseDB 提供的安装程序下载并安装 PostgreSQL-9.6(standard)

下载链接

2) 从菜单打开 Stack builder -> 从列表中选择要安装 pgAgent 的 Postgres 服务器

在此处输入图像描述

在此处输入图像描述

3) 现在选择 pgAgent 并单击 Next 安装并按照步骤操作。

在此处输入图像描述

4)重新启动pgAdmin4,您将能够在浏览器窗口树中看到pgAgent选项。

(我正在使用 pgAdmin4 rc build,所以图标可能看起来不同)

在此处输入图像描述

于 2017-09-25T06:32:28.707 回答
0

就我而言,我已经安装了 PostgreSQL 9.6,但没有该程序的开始菜单文件夹。但我能够从以下文件夹启动 stackbuilder.exe:C:\Program Files\PostgreSQL\9.6\bin。休息一下,我按照说明看到了“pgAgent Jobs”。我只是想知道 pgAgent 是否具有高级作业链接和依赖项,但情况似乎并非如此。

于 2018-06-17T10:23:34.293 回答